About Us


We believe in the ability that exists within every child who has developmental disabilities and that all children deserve the opportunity to reach their full potential.

Over the past two decades, McCarton has transformed the lives of thousands of children from around the globe through the McCarton Center for Developmental Pediatrics, the McCarton School for children with autism, and the Children’s Academy for children with speech and language learning delays. In 2018 the McCarton Foundation launched an Early Intervention program, providing services to infants and toddlers diagnosed with autism and other developmental disabilities. 


We utilize the McCarton Integrated Model, which combines speech and language therapy, fine and gross motor therapy, sensory integration therapy, socialization with peers, developmental play skills, and applied behavior analysis (ABA) therapy. 


Job Description


Working under an ABA Therapist's direct supervision, the ABA Assistant will provide in-person support to children aged 2-3 years old diagnosed with autism spectrum disorder. They will assist therapists in implementing Applied Behavior Analysis programming and provide additional support to families and children in a home-based setting. The role will require communicating with caregivers and a diverse clinical team of ABA, Occupational, Physical and Speech Therapists.


Responsibilities and Duties:


  • Work collaboratively with an ABA Therapist to implement basic principles and teaching procedures of ABA Therapy

  • Support caregivers and families with modeling ABA program, managing challenging behaviors, and assisting with technology

  • Provide encouragement to both child and caregiver

  • Follow Health & Safety policies including the use of PPE, handwashing, and sanitation procedures

  • Communicate with our clinical team of Speech, Occupational and Physical Therapists
